Спасибо автору за выполненную работу! Все верно, преподаватель принял работу. Рекомендую всем!
Подробнее о работе
Гарантия сервиса Автор24
Уникальность не ниже 50%
1. АНАЛИЗ ИСХОДНЫХ ДАННЫХ И ОРГАНИЗАЦИЯ ОБЩЕЙ СТРУКТУРЫ
Устройство ввода состоит из блока цифровой программной обработки и интерфейсного блока, работающих одновременно и обеспечивающих обработку и ввод информации в ПЭВМ. ПЭВМ программно реализует ряд функций приема, обработки и накопления информации. Блок цифровой обработки должен обеспечивать вычисление функций входных значений. Основной функцией разрабатываемой вычислительной системы является частное от деления двух последних принятых входных значений. Для упрощения поставленной задачи ограничимся тем, что входные и выходные данные являются целыми положительными числами.
2. Анализ структуры вычислительной системы.
Структурная схема ЭВМ серии К1810, отражающая состав функциональных блоков ЭВМ и логические связи между ними, приведена на рис. 2.
3. Разработка программы
Согласно заданию необходимо составить алгоритм вычисления среднего арифметического N=20 последовательно принятых входных значений. Среднее арифметическое считается по формуле:
4. Определение параметров подсистемы памяти
Микропрограмма обработки получаемых данных хранится в ПЗУ, поэтому необходимо знать, какой объем памяти занимает программа. Чтобы высчитать этот объем, нужно знать формат команд, использующихся программой. Формат команд зависит от типа операции и может быть одно-, двух- или трехбайтовыми. Байты двух- и трехбайтовых команд должны храниться в ячейках памяти, следующих одна за другой. Адрес первого операнда всегда является адресом кода операции.
В Табл.1 представлены команды микропроцессора, длины команд и число тактов. Пользуясь данными таблицы рассчитаем объем памяти, необходимый для хранения программы и констант в ПЗУ.
5. Анализ характеристик вычислительной системы
Одной из важнейших характеристик разрабатываемого ВУ является синхронизация. В разрабатываемом устройстве применяется синхронизация от таймера.
Синхронизацию можно организовать двумя способами:
используя микросхему программируемого таймера КР580ВИ53
по расчетному времени выполнения программы.
Второй способ более предпочтителен, так как требует меньших аппаратных и программных затрат.
Оценивая время выполнения каждой команды мы можем посчитать, сколько в среднем необходимо времени для выполнения определенной части программы. Таким образом при условии длительности такта синхронизации 200 нс мы получаем следующие значения:
- инициализация – 3511 тактов 702200 нс
- ввод данных - 22 такта или 4400 нс
- деление - 194 такта или 38800 нс
- вывод данных - 25 тактов или 3100 нс
6. Синтез функциональной схемы
Функциональная схема вычислительной системы приведена в графической части курсовой работы.
6.1 Микросхема КР1810ВМ86.
Основой модуля является центральный процессор, в роли которого выступает микропроцессор КР1810ВМ86, который отображен на рис.5.
1. АНАЛИЗ ИСХОДНЫХ ДАННЫХ И ОРГАНИЗАЦИЯ ОБЩЕЙ СТРУКТУРЫ
Структура системы представлена на рис. 1.
Входной Выходной
цифровой код УВ цифровой код ПЭВМ
Рис.1 Структура разрабатываемой вычислительной системы
Устройство ввода состоит из блока цифровой программной обработки и интерфейсного блока, работающих одновременно и обеспечивающих обработку и ввод информации в ПЭВМ. ПЭВМ программно реализует ряд функций приема, обработки и накопления информации. Блок цифровой обработки должен обеспечивать вычисление функций входных значений. Основной функцией разрабатываемой вычислительной системы является частное от деления двух последних принятых входных значений. Для упрощения поставленной задачи ограничимся тем, что входные и выходные данные являются целыми положительными числами.
3. Разработка программы
Согласно заданию необходимо составить алгоритм вычисления среднего арифметического N=20 последовательно принятых входных значений. Среднее арифметическое считается по формуле:
Полученный алгоритм приведен на блок-схеме.
Рис.
...
4. Определение параметров подсистемы памяти
Микропрограмма обработки получаемых данных хранится в ПЗУ, поэтому необходимо знать, какой объем памяти занимает программа. Чтобы высчитать этот объем, нужно знать формат команд, использующихся программой. Формат команд зависит от типа операции и может быть одно-, двух- или трехбайтовыми. Байты двух- и трехбайтовых команд должны храниться в ячейках памяти, следующих одна за другой. Адрес первого операнда всегда является адресом кода операции.
В Табл.1 представлены команды микропроцессора, длины команд и число тактов. Пользуясь данными таблицы рассчитаем объем памяти, необходимый для хранения программы и констант в ПЗУ.
...
5. Анализ характеристик вычислительной системы
Одной из важнейших характеристик разрабатываемого ВУ является синхронизация. В разрабатываемом устройстве применяется синхронизация от таймера.
Синхронизацию можно организовать двумя способами:
• используя микросхему программируемого таймера КР580ВИ53
• по расчетному времени выполнения программы.
Второй способ более предпочтителен, так как требует меньших аппаратных и программных затрат.
Оценивая время выполнения каждой команды мы можем посчитать, сколько в среднем необходимо времени для выполнения определенной части программы.
...
6.1 Микросхема КР1810ВМ86.
Основой модуля является центральный процессор, в роли которого выступает микропроцессор КР1810ВМ86, который отображен на рис.5.
рис.
...
1.ГОСТ 2.004-88 ЕСКД. Общие требования к выполнению конструкторских и технологических документов на печатающих и графических устройствах вывода ЭВМ.
2.ГОСТ 19.701-90 ЕСПД. Схемы алгоритмов, программы данных и систем. Условные обозначения и правила выполнения.
3.ГОСТ 2.743-91 ЕСКД. Обозначения условные графические в схемах. Элементы цифровой техники.
4.ГОСТ 2.708-81 ЕСКД. Правила выполнения электрических схем цифровой вычислительной техники.
5.Усатенко С.Т., Каченюк Т.К., Терехова М.В. Выполнение электрических схем по ЕСКД – М.: Издательство стандартов, 1989 – 325с.
6. Цифровые и аналоговые интегральные микросхемы: Справочник / С.В. Якубовский и др. –М.: Радио и связь, 1989. –496с.
7. Прянишников В.А. Электроника: Курс лекций. – СПб,: «КОРОНА – принт», 1998. – 400 с.
8. Однокристальные микро ЭВМ: Справочник /Боборыкин А.В., Липовецкий Г.П. и др.. – М.: МИКАП, 1994. – 400 с.
9. Проектирование микропроцессорной электронно-вычислительной аппаратуры: Справочник /В.Г.Артюхов, А.А.Будняк, В.Ю, Лапий и др. – К.: Техника, 1988. – 263 с.
10. Микропроцессорный комплект К1810:структура, программирование, применение. Справочная книга/ Ю.М. Казаринов, В.Н. Номоконов, Г.С. Подклетнов, Ф.В. Филиппов/. – М.: Высшая школа, 1990. – 269 с.
Не подошла эта работа?
Закажи новую работу, сделанную по твоим требованиям
1. АНАЛИЗ ИСХОДНЫХ ДАННЫХ И ОРГАНИЗАЦИЯ ОБЩЕЙ СТРУКТУРЫ
Устройство ввода состоит из блока цифровой программной обработки и интерфейсного блока, работающих одновременно и обеспечивающих обработку и ввод информации в ПЭВМ. ПЭВМ программно реализует ряд функций приема, обработки и накопления информации. Блок цифровой обработки должен обеспечивать вычисление функций входных значений. Основной функцией разрабатываемой вычислительной системы является частное от деления двух последних принятых входных значений. Для упрощения поставленной задачи ограничимся тем, что входные и выходные данные являются целыми положительными числами.
2. Анализ структуры вычислительной системы.
Структурная схема ЭВМ серии К1810, отражающая состав функциональных блоков ЭВМ и логические связи между ними, приведена на рис. 2.
3. Разработка программы
Согласно заданию необходимо составить алгоритм вычисления среднего арифметического N=20 последовательно принятых входных значений. Среднее арифметическое считается по формуле:
4. Определение параметров подсистемы памяти
Микропрограмма обработки получаемых данных хранится в ПЗУ, поэтому необходимо знать, какой объем памяти занимает программа. Чтобы высчитать этот объем, нужно знать формат команд, использующихся программой. Формат команд зависит от типа операции и может быть одно-, двух- или трехбайтовыми. Байты двух- и трехбайтовых команд должны храниться в ячейках памяти, следующих одна за другой. Адрес первого операнда всегда является адресом кода операции.
В Табл.1 представлены команды микропроцессора, длины команд и число тактов. Пользуясь данными таблицы рассчитаем объем памяти, необходимый для хранения программы и констант в ПЗУ.
5. Анализ характеристик вычислительной системы
Одной из важнейших характеристик разрабатываемого ВУ является синхронизация. В разрабатываемом устройстве применяется синхронизация от таймера.
Синхронизацию можно организовать двумя способами:
используя микросхему программируемого таймера КР580ВИ53
по расчетному времени выполнения программы.
Второй способ более предпочтителен, так как требует меньших аппаратных и программных затрат.
Оценивая время выполнения каждой команды мы можем посчитать, сколько в среднем необходимо времени для выполнения определенной части программы. Таким образом при условии длительности такта синхронизации 200 нс мы получаем следующие значения:
- инициализация – 3511 тактов 702200 нс
- ввод данных - 22 такта или 4400 нс
- деление - 194 такта или 38800 нс
- вывод данных - 25 тактов или 3100 нс
6. Синтез функциональной схемы
Функциональная схема вычислительной системы приведена в графической части курсовой работы.
6.1 Микросхема КР1810ВМ86.
Основой модуля является центральный процессор, в роли которого выступает микропроцессор КР1810ВМ86, который отображен на рис.5.
1. АНАЛИЗ ИСХОДНЫХ ДАННЫХ И ОРГАНИЗАЦИЯ ОБЩЕЙ СТРУКТУРЫ
Структура системы представлена на рис. 1.
Входной Выходной
цифровой код УВ цифровой код ПЭВМ
Рис.1 Структура разрабатываемой вычислительной системы
Устройство ввода состоит из блока цифровой программной обработки и интерфейсного блока, работающих одновременно и обеспечивающих обработку и ввод информации в ПЭВМ. ПЭВМ программно реализует ряд функций приема, обработки и накопления информации. Блок цифровой обработки должен обеспечивать вычисление функций входных значений. Основной функцией разрабатываемой вычислительной системы является частное от деления двух последних принятых входных значений. Для упрощения поставленной задачи ограничимся тем, что входные и выходные данные являются целыми положительными числами.
3. Разработка программы
Согласно заданию необходимо составить алгоритм вычисления среднего арифметического N=20 последовательно принятых входных значений. Среднее арифметическое считается по формуле:
Полученный алгоритм приведен на блок-схеме.
Рис.
...
4. Определение параметров подсистемы памяти
Микропрограмма обработки получаемых данных хранится в ПЗУ, поэтому необходимо знать, какой объем памяти занимает программа. Чтобы высчитать этот объем, нужно знать формат команд, использующихся программой. Формат команд зависит от типа операции и может быть одно-, двух- или трехбайтовыми. Байты двух- и трехбайтовых команд должны храниться в ячейках памяти, следующих одна за другой. Адрес первого операнда всегда является адресом кода операции.
В Табл.1 представлены команды микропроцессора, длины команд и число тактов. Пользуясь данными таблицы рассчитаем объем памяти, необходимый для хранения программы и констант в ПЗУ.
...
5. Анализ характеристик вычислительной системы
Одной из важнейших характеристик разрабатываемого ВУ является синхронизация. В разрабатываемом устройстве применяется синхронизация от таймера.
Синхронизацию можно организовать двумя способами:
• используя микросхему программируемого таймера КР580ВИ53
• по расчетному времени выполнения программы.
Второй способ более предпочтителен, так как требует меньших аппаратных и программных затрат.
Оценивая время выполнения каждой команды мы можем посчитать, сколько в среднем необходимо времени для выполнения определенной части программы.
...
6.1 Микросхема КР1810ВМ86.
Основой модуля является центральный процессор, в роли которого выступает микропроцессор КР1810ВМ86, который отображен на рис.5.
рис.
...
1.ГОСТ 2.004-88 ЕСКД. Общие требования к выполнению конструкторских и технологических документов на печатающих и графических устройствах вывода ЭВМ.
2.ГОСТ 19.701-90 ЕСПД. Схемы алгоритмов, программы данных и систем. Условные обозначения и правила выполнения.
3.ГОСТ 2.743-91 ЕСКД. Обозначения условные графические в схемах. Элементы цифровой техники.
4.ГОСТ 2.708-81 ЕСКД. Правила выполнения электрических схем цифровой вычислительной техники.
5.Усатенко С.Т., Каченюк Т.К., Терехова М.В. Выполнение электрических схем по ЕСКД – М.: Издательство стандартов, 1989 – 325с.
6. Цифровые и аналоговые интегральные микросхемы: Справочник / С.В. Якубовский и др. –М.: Радио и связь, 1989. –496с.
7. Прянишников В.А. Электроника: Курс лекций. – СПб,: «КОРОНА – принт», 1998. – 400 с.
8. Однокристальные микро ЭВМ: Справочник /Боборыкин А.В., Липовецкий Г.П. и др.. – М.: МИКАП, 1994. – 400 с.
9. Проектирование микропроцессорной электронно-вычислительной аппаратуры: Справочник /В.Г.Артюхов, А.А.Будняк, В.Ю, Лапий и др. – К.: Техника, 1988. – 263 с.
10. Микропроцессорный комплект К1810:структура, программирование, применение. Справочная книга/ Ю.М. Казаринов, В.Н. Номоконов, Г.С. Подклетнов, Ф.В. Филиппов/. – М.: Высшая школа, 1990. – 269 с.
Купить эту работу vs Заказать новую | ||
---|---|---|
0 раз | Куплено | Выполняется индивидуально |
Не менее 40%
Исполнитель, загружая работу в «Банк готовых работ» подтверждает, что
уровень оригинальности
работы составляет не менее 40%
|
Уникальность | Выполняется индивидуально |
Сразу в личном кабинете | Доступность | Срок 1—6 дней |
730 ₽ | Цена | от 500 ₽ |
Не подошла эта работа?
В нашей базе 149278 Курсовых работ — поможем найти подходящую